The procedure regulates the method of obtaining the permit required for the sale of agricultural land outside the built-up area
The permit required for the alienation of agricultural land outside the built-up area may be requested by any person who owns agricultural land outside the built-up area, for the purpose of selling. The individual/legal entity will submit the application for posting the land sale offer (ANNEX 1A form), in order to notify the preemptors, accompanied by the land sale offer (ANNEX 1B form) and the supporting documents.
Within 5 working days from the registration of the application, the sale offer will be posted for 45 working days at the Săliștea Commune Town Hall headquarters and on the Town Hall website.
Within 5 working days from the registration of the sale application, the specialized department within the Town Hall will draw up the list of preemptors, which will be posted at the Town Hall headquarters and on the website.
During the 45 working days from the posting of the sale offer, the Town Hall will register all communications of acceptance of the land sale offer (ANNEX 1E form), submitted by any of the preemptors, accompanied by the following documents:
- copy of ID/ID card for the individual preemptor;
- copy of the certificate issued by the Trade Registry in the case of the legal entity preemptor;
- notarized copies of the supporting documents certifying the status of preemptor (co-ownership documents, lease contract, ownership documents of real estate bordering the land for sale, etc.).
The seller's decision regarding the selection of the preemptor as potential buyer will be registered at the Town Hall.
Within 3 working days from its registration, the specialized department will communicate, where appropriate, to M.A.D.R. or D.A.D.R. AB, the name and identification data of the selected preemptor, potential buyer.
The final permit required for entering into the authentic sale contract by the public notary is issued, as appropriate, by M.A.D.R. or D.A.D.R. AB.
If no preemptor communicates acceptance of the seller's offer, and the sale is free, the specialized department will issue the seller a certificate attesting that all procedural steps regarding the exercise of the right of preemption have been completed and that the land is free for sale, at the price provided in the sale offer. The certificate will be accompanied by a certified copy of the original sale offer.
Required documents:
- application for posting the land sale offer (ANNEX 1A form);
- land sale offer (ANNEX 1B form);
- a photocopy of the ID card of the individual seller or a copy of the passport for the individual seller with domicile abroad;
- a photocopy certified for conformity by the town hall officials of the ownership document for the land subject to the sale offer (as applicable: sale-purchase contract, donation contract, final and irrevocable civil sentence/decision, title deed, inheritance certificate, exchange contract, liquidation deed of patrimony or any other document provided by law attesting the acquisition of ownership);
- land register extract for information, issued not more than 30 days before posting the offer, accompanied by a cadastral plan extract, if the land is registered in the integrated cadastre and land register system;
- a photocopy of the certificate issued by the trade register or the document based on which it operates, in the case of the legal entity seller;
- in case of representation, notarial power of attorney, in a photocopy certified for conformity by the town hall officials, respectively delegation, decision of the general meeting of associates, decision of the sole associate, decision of the representative of the associative form, as applicable, in original, as well as a photocopy of the ID/ID card/passport of the empowered individual;
- decision of the general meeting of associates, decision of the sole associate, decision of the representative of the associative form, as applicable, in original, indicating the agreement regarding the sale of the asset owned by the company, in the case of the legal entity seller;
- tax attestation certificate issued by the town hall;
- other supporting documents, as applicable.
